ARLINGTON, VA. (THECOUNT)– WUSA 9 is reporting that Arlington County police are responding to the report of a shooting at the Ballston Quarter mall — formerly known as Ballston Mall.
The Office of Emergency Management says they were responding to a possible shooting at the mall. The alert location was listed at 4238 Wilson Boulevard.
The mall and theater are located near the Ballston-MU Metro Station.
Police have not yet found any evidence of a shooting at this time. No injuries have been reported. Authorities are asking people to avoid the mall and the theater.
The theater remains under a shelter in place while officers search the area.
